Hero Name Recognition Learning Application Using the Fisher-Yates Algorithm

##plugins.themes.bootstrap3.article.main##

Muhammad Aldito Ardiansyah R. M. Nasrul Halim

Abstract

Application of technology in learning activities is the right decision, because most children have a great sense of curiosity, such as curiosity about heroes. Heroes are historical figures who contribute to the development of nations and countries. A use of technology that can be used is a learning application and is generally made in the form of quiz games. Quiz games are games that are played by answering existing questions. The questions were randomly selected using the Fisher-Yates algorithm. The Fisher-Yates algorithm is a calculation by creating random variations of existing sets. The Multimedia Development Life Cycle method is employed in this research as it is suitable for building multimedia application systems. In this development, the test stage uses the black box testing method. Based on the research results and the development process, it can be concluded that the application of the Fisher-Yates algorithm can run well in randomizing questions based on the results of 15 trial tests. And according to the black box testing results, it indicates that the created application can be used properly.

##plugins.themes.bootstrap3.article.details##

Section
Articles
References
[1] J. Hendrawan and I. Perwitasari, “Aplikasi Pengenalan Pahlawan Nasional Dan Pahlawan Revolusi Berbasis Android,” Jurnal Teknologi Informasi, vol. 3, no. 1, 2019.
[2] S. Sam’ani, M. H. Qamaruzzaman, and S. Sutami, “Rancang Bangun Biografi Pahlawan Nasional Berbasis Android,” Jurnal Ilmiah Informatika, vol. 5, no. 2, pp. 133–143, Dec. 2020, doi: 10.35316/jimi.v5i2.892.
[3] R. A. Putri, A. Wahyuni, and B. Purnomo, “Perjuangan Karakter Cinta Tanah Air Dari Seorang Pahlawan Revolusi Pierre Tendean,” Jurnal Pendidikan Sejarah & Sejarah FKIP Universitas Jambi, vol. 1, no. 1, pp. 20–32, 2022.
[4] G. Tiara, W. Hidayah, and K. Artaye, “Media Ajar Sejarah Pahlawan Pada Uang Kertas Emisi 2016 Menggunakan Teknologi Augmented Reality,” 2019.
[5] R. Ibrahim, “Implementasi Fisher Yates Shuffle dan Non Player Character pada Permainan Tembak Setan,” Walisongo Journal of Information Technology, vol. 2, no. 2, p. 137, Dec. 2020, doi: 10.21580/wjit.2020.2.2.7048.
[6] R. Syaifulloh, “Perancangan Game Edukasi Sebagai Media Pembelajaran Berbasis Mobile Menggunakan Algoritma Fisher-Yates Dan Flood Fill,” Klik - Kumpulan Jurnal Ilmu Komputer, vol. 8, no. 1, 2021.
[7] A. Muhammad Kannabi, “Implementasi Algoritma Fisher-Yates Shuffle Game pada Pembelajaran Huruf Hijaiyah Implementation of the Fisher-Yates Shuffle Game Algorithm in Learning Hijaiyah Letters,” SISTEMASI: Jurnal Sistem Informasi, vol. 11, no. 3, 2022, [Online]. Available: http://sistemasi.ftik.unisi.ac.id
[8] Y. Arviansyah and R. Waluyo, “Penerapan Algoritma Fisher Yates Shuffle Pada Aplikasi TOEFL Preparation Berbasis Web,” Jurnal Buana Informatika, vol. 11, no. 2, pp. 112–122, 2020.
[9] V. Asih, A. Saputra, and R. T. Subagio, “Penerapan Algoritma Fisher Yates Shuffle Untuk Aplikasi Ujian Berbasis Android,” Jurnal Digit, vol. 10, no. 1, pp. 59–70, 2020.
[10] A. Wijaya and Y. Apridiansyah, “Penerapan Algortima Fisher Yates Shuflle Pada Media Pembelajaran Mapel Agama Islam Berbasis Android,” Jurnal Informatika Upgris, vol. 6, no. 1, 2020.
[11] D. Nurdiana and A. Suryadi, “Perancangan Game Budayaku Indonesiaku Menggunakan Metode Mdlc,” Jurnal Petik, vol. 3, 2018.
[12] Rohmat Indra Borman and Yogi Purwanto, “Impelementasi Multimedia Development Life Cycle pada Pengembangan Game Edukasi Pengenalan Bahaya Sampah pada Anak,” JEPIN (Jurnal Edukasi dan Penelitian Informatika), vol. 5, no. 2, 2019.
[13] P. R. Sandri, A. Trisnadoli, and E. S. Nugroho, “Pengembangan Game Edukasi Pengenalan Bahasa Inggris Dasar untuk Anak TK,” Smatika Jurnal, vol. 9, no. 02, pp. 59–64, 2020, doi: 10.32664/smatika.v9i02.384.
[14] M. Minarni and S. Sigit, “Pengujian Fungsionalitas dan Kualitas Website Wisata Kotawaringin Timur Menggunakan Metode Black Box dan Standar ISO,” J-Intech, vol. 11, no. 1, pp. 18–25, 2023, doi: 10.32664/j-intech.v11i1.820.
[15] A. P. Kusuma, M. F. Rahmat, and A. A. Rofiq, “Analisis Pengujian Sistem Pengiriman Barang Menggunakan Black Box Testing,” J-Intech, vol. 11, no. 2, pp. 287–293, 2023, doi: 10.32664/j-intech.v11i2.999.
[16] R. R. C. Putra, T. Sugihartono, and F. Panca Juniawan, “Aplikasi Augmented Reality Media Pembelajaran Pengenalan Gambar Tokoh Pahlawan Nasional Pada Uang Kertas Berbasis Android,” Jurnal Sisfokom (Sistem Informasi dan Komputer), vol. 10, no. 3, pp. 405–412, Dec. 2021, doi: 10.32736/sisfokom.v10i3.1285.
[17] P. Harsadi, W. L. Y. Saptomo, and C. Y. Wardhana, “Implementasi Algoritma Fisher-Yates Shuffle Pada Game Edukasi Aksara Jawa Menggunakan Godot Engine,” Jurnal Teknologi Informasi dan Komunikasi (TIKomSiN), vol. 10, no. 1, May 2022, doi: 10.30646/tikomsin.v10i1.603.